Step-by-Step Assembly

1. Prepare Your Workspace

  • Use a large, clean table with good lighting.
  • Keep a screwdriver, zip ties, and a thermal paste (if not pre-applied) handy.
  • Ground yourself to avoid static electricity—touch metal or use an anti-static wrist strap.

2. Install the CPU on the Motherboard

  • Open the CPU socket: Lift the retention arm on the motherboard’s CPU socket.
  • Place the CPU: Align the golden triangle on the CPU with the marker on the socket and gently drop it in place.
  • Secure the CPU: Lower the retention arm to lock it.

3. Install the RAM

  • Find the DIMM slots on the motherboard.
  • Open the latches and align the RAM stick with the notch in the slot.
  • Push it down until it clicks into place.

4. Attach the CPU Cooler

  • Apply thermal paste if needed (a pea-sized dot on the CPU).
  • Mount the AIO cooler onto the CPU and screw it securely.
  • Attach the cooler’s fans and radiator to the case.

5. Install the Motherboard into the Case

  • Screw in the standoffs in the case to match the holes in your motherboard.
  • Carefully place the motherboard in the case and secure it with screws.

6. Install the GPU

  • Find the PCIe slot on the motherboard (usually the top slot).
  • Remove the slot cover from the case.
  • Insert the RTX 5090 into the PCIe slot and screw it in place for stability.

7. Connect the Power Supply (PSU)

  • Place the PSU in its compartment (usually at the bottom or back of the case).
  • Connect the following cables:
    • 24-pin cable to the motherboard.
    • 8-pin EPS cable to the CPU socket.
    • PCIe power cables to the GPU.

8. Install Storage

  • Insert the M.2 SSD into the M.2 slot on the motherboard.
  • Secure it with the small screw provided.

9. Connect Cables

  • Plug in the front panel connectors (power button, USB, etc.) to the motherboard.
  • Route all cables through the case for a clean look. Use zip ties to organize them.

10. Test Your Build

  • Connect the monitor, keyboard, and mouse.
  • Turn on the power and boot into the BIOS to check if all components are recognized.

11. Install the Operating System (OS)

  • Use a USB drive to install Windows 11 or Linux.
  • Download the latest drivers for your GPU, motherboard, and other components.

Yearly Highlights in Detail

2020: The Ray Tracing Revolution

  • NVIDIA launched the RTX 30-series, bringing ray tracing (realistic lighting effects) to mainstream gaming.
  • AMD’s Ryzen 5000 CPUs challenged Intel, offering better value for gaming and multitasking.
  • Gamers embraced 16GB DDR4 RAM as the sweet spot for high-performance gaming.

2021: Rise of 4K Gaming

  • NVIDIA’s RTX 3090 offered unparalleled power for gaming, content creation, and 3D rendering.
  • Intel’s 11th Gen CPUs focused on gaming performance, improving single-core speeds.
  • 120Hz and 144Hz 4K monitors became more affordable, boosting smooth gameplay for competitive gamers.

2022: Next-Generation Tech

  • DDR5 RAM and PCIe 5.0 SSDs brought faster memory and storage, slashing load times for games.
  • AMD’s RX 7900 XTX competed with NVIDIA in price-to-performance for 4K gaming.
  • Intel’s 12th Gen CPUs (Alder Lake) introduced a hybrid architecture with performance and efficiency cores.

2023: AI-Driven Performance

  • NVIDIA’s RTX 4090 used DLSS 3 to generate AI-powered frames, improving performance without sacrificing graphics.
  • AMD’s Ryzen 7000 series, especially the 7950X, excelled in gaming and productivity tasks.
  • Cooling systems became more efficient, with energy-saving GPUs and CPUs lowering power bills.
